The current collie doesn't print spaces after the progress bar to the
end of line, so the error message aren't be formated correctly.

For example:

  $ collie vdi check test
   98.0 % [============================>] 196 MB / 200 MB   f
  ixed missing 7c2b2500000011
  100.0 % [=============================] 200 MB / 200 MB
  finish check&repair test

This fixes the problem.
